Classroom Provision
Quality First Teaching means that all teachers are aware of the needs of their pupils and will differentiate accordingly. The Learning Support Department works in close liaison with the Inclusive Foundation and the school subject teachers to help pupils develop suitable strategies to support their learning and become independent learners. Learning Support staff also provide continual professional development on learning difficulties for classroom colleagues throughout the year.
If a student has a greater difficulty in learning than the majority of students of the same age, then they may need ‘special educational provision’ through targeted intervention sessions. The Learning Support Department provides personalized one to one, or small group lessons designed to support students’ ability to access and participate in the high quality teaching and learning available throughout the school. Howard Academy offers one-on-one tutoring, after school group study sessions, and full day program options to meet the needs of students and families. There is an additional charge for these sessions.
